If B is the midpoint of AC, then |AB| = |AC|.
|AB| = 3x + 2
|BC| = 5x - 10
Therefore we have the equation:
3x + 2 = 5x - 10 |subtract 2 from both sides
3x = 5x - 12 |subtract 5x from both sides
-2x = -12 |divide both sides by (-2)
x = 6
